Transaction 2923e5a36757c5287647213b33b746e78ecb9a160e0473df77de7888950a98e1

34 Input
2 Outputs
  • 2923e5a36757c5287647213b33b746e78ecb9a160e0473df77de7888950a98e1:0
  • value  6700000000
    address  1HswjJrfayDmULBFJP9WWWgeJ5h6bDVYi8
  • 2923e5a36757c5287647213b33b746e78ecb9a160e0473df77de7888950a98e1:1
  • value  65347332
    address  17GwRWYDAFrLY3yeV5USteHuV9ofE84Q76